What is the empirical formula for fatty acids?
Fatty acids are organic compounds that have the general formula CH3(CH2)nCOOH, where n usually ranges from 2 to 28 and is always an even number. There are two types of fatty acids: saturated fatty acids and unsaturated fatty acids.

What is fatty acids chemical formula?
17.1: Fatty Acids
| Name | Abbreviated Structural Formula | Condensed Structural Formula |
|---|---|---|
| stearic acid | C17H35COOH | CH3(CH2)16COOH |
| oleic acid | C17H33COOH | CH3(CH2)7CH=CH(CH2)7COOH |
| linoleic acid | C17H31COOH | CH3(CH2)3(CH2CH=CH)2(CH2)7COOH |
| α-linolenic acid | C17H29COOH | CH3(CH2CH=CH)3(CH2)7COOH |

What is the formula for an unsaturated fatty acid?
If one double bond is present it is called mono-unsaturated fatty acid (MUFAs) and if it contains 2 or more double bonds it is called poly-unsaturated fatty acid (PUFAs). The general formula of unsaturated fatty acid is as- CH3(CH2)nCH=CH(CH2)nCOOH where n can be any integer.

How do you analyze fatty acids?
Fatty acids are commonly analyzed by gas chromatography (GC) after conversion to fatty acid methyl esters (FAMEs) which are more easily separated and quantified than either triglycerides or free fatty acids. In most methods the fat is saponified, which liberates the fatty acids from triglycerides, phospholipids, etc.
What is ester content?
Ester content is used to determine the oil conversion into biodiesel (i.e., is related to the final biodiesel purity). The standard EN 14214 uses the method EN 14103 to determine the content of ester and linolenic acid and the EN 15779 for PUFA.

What percent of ALA is converted to EPA DHA?
ALA, the most common omega-3 fat, is an essential fatty acid that is converted into EPA and DHA ( 3 ). However, this conversion process is inefficient in humans. On average, only 1–10% of ALA is converted into EPA and 0.5–5% into DHA ( 4 , 5 , 6 , 22 ).

What foods provide omega-3s?
- Fish and other seafood (especially cold-water fatty fish, such as salmon, mackerel, tuna, herring, and sardines)
- Nuts and seeds (such as flaxseed, chia seeds, and walnuts)
- Plant oils (such as flaxseed oil, soybean oil, and canola oil)

How can I quantify unsaturated fatty acids in meat fat?
If you want to quantify unsaturated fatty acids in meat fat, better option would be AOAC official method 996.06 by GC-FID. By using this method you will be able to identify and quantify around 50 different fatty acids, then the sum of trans, saturated, monounsatured and polyunsatured fatty acids.
